A car of mass m starts from rest and acquires a velocity along east `upsilon = upsilonhati (upsilon gt 0)` in two seconds Assuming the car moves with unifrom acceleration the force exerted on the car is .

A

`(mv)/(2)` eastward and is exerted by the car engine.

B

`(mv)/(2)` eastward and is due to the friction on the tyres exerted by the road.

C

more than `(mv)/(2)` eastward exerted due to the engine and overcomes the frictions of the road.

D

`(mv)/(2)` exerted by the engine.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B

Given, mass of the car =m As car starts from rest `u =0`
Velocity acquired along east `=vhati`
Duration ` =t =2s`
We know `v =u + at`
`rArr vhati = 0 + a xx 2`
`rArr a = (v)/(2) hati`
Force `F = ma = (mv)/(2) hati`
Hence, force acting on the car is `(mv)/(2)` towards east As external force on the system is only friction hence the force `(mv)/(v)` is by friction Hence, force by egine is internal force .
